本文主要展示“如何在数据库中使用管理选项和授予选项”。内容简单易懂,条理清晰。希望能帮你解开疑惑。让边肖带领你学习文章“如何在数据库中使用管理选项和授权选项”。
1、带有管理选项
使用admin选项意味着被授予此权限的用户有权向其他用户或角色授予特定权限(如创建任何表),取消不会级联。
例如,如果A被授予使用管理员选项创建会话的权限,那么A将创建会话的权限授予B,但是当管理员收回A的创建会话权限时,B仍然拥有创建会话的权限。但是管理员可以明确撤销B创建会话的权限,即直接从B处撤销创建会话。
2、有授予选择权
带有授予选项意味着:权限授予/取消是级联的。例如,当使用with grant选项进行对象授权时,被授权的用户也可以将此对象权限授予其他用户或角色。不同之处在于,当管理员撤回使用grant选项授权的用户对象权限时,该权限将因传播而无效。例如,将带有授予选项的SELECT ON TABLE授予A,用户A将此权限授予B,但当管理员撤销A的权限时,B的权限也将无效,但管理员不能直接撤销B的权限。
这就是文章“如何在数据库中使用admin选项和grant选项”的全部内容。感谢您的阅读!相信大家都有一定的了解,希望分享的内容对大家有所帮助。想了解更多知识,请关注行业资讯频道!
内容来源网络,如有侵权,联系删除,本文地址:https://www.230890.com/zhan/112492.html